Fawzia Ali is an accomplished Special Education Teacher at the Intensive Learning Center, where she plays a pivotal role in supporting at-risk youth in grades 9 through 12. With a deep commitment to fostering inclusive educational environments, Fawzia specializes in differentiated instruction tailored to meet the unique needs of her students. Her expertise in behavior management and response to intervention (RTI) strategies allows her to create personalized learning experiences that empower students to overcome challenges and thrive academically.
At the Intensive Learning Center, Fawzia leads key projects aimed at enhancing educational outcomes for students with diverse learning needs, including those on the autism spectrum. By integrating instructional technology and educational technology into her curriculum, she not only engages her students but also equips them with essential skills for their future endeavors. Fawzia’s innovative approach to classroom management fosters a safe and supportive atmosphere, enabling students to express themselves and develop their social-emotional skills.
In addition to her teaching responsibilities, Fawzia actively participates in community outreach initiatives, such as the Laulima Alliance for Higher Education's Annual Golf Fundraiser. This event not only raises crucial funds for educational programs but also highlights the importance of collaboration between educators, families, and the community in supporting at-risk youth. Fawzia’s dedication to her students and her passion for special education make her a vital asset to the Intensive Learning Center and a champion for the future of her students.
